Installed so I guess it counts: A new Freeview antenna at my mum's cottage in Sennen. Because there's not people here on a continuous basis we let the Sky lapse but the antenna for Freeview blew down in the winter storms. Can't face only having five useless channels so got a man* in to fit a new one.

Got him to fit a new mast and lashing kit as the old one was very rusty. Opted for a mid range log periodic antenna, the old one was a complete POS, 4 year warranty parts and labour. Now got some decent channels and no pixelation. :D

A pair of Denon AH-W200 wireless earphones. While (as noted in http://www.digitaltrends.com/headpho...h-w200-review/) they do have problems with bluetooth dropouts, and awkward controls (which I don't really use), as well as making the user look like he or she is wearing two old school hearing aids, they do sound a lot better than my old Sennheisers, and offer 4 to 5 hours playback on one charge. They also have a wired backup connection, and become passive when that is used, so you can use them even if the battery is flat.

I also bought a Samsung T1 external SSD. Not cheap, but gives 512Gb storage and is blindingly fast on the USB3 socket.
